Output ef583eb55cc93134e8a32ed664c76d2beab63e6e26db8d61d80a04710a4e2007:1

value
1254464
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c73bf8e8017a52651da3f693ebfcf1eca6b82c2 OP_EQUALVERIFY OP_CHECKSIG
address
1FGF5Frt2zewh29ftoCxCFYuQ1LxmZbfUU
transaction
ef583eb55cc93134e8a32ed664c76d2beab63e6e26db8d61d80a04710a4e2007
confirmations
493666
spent
true